Output e36cc598c59cf35c60b8afc196b86762ad0ae430c0b6c878ea68c549dbf357af:1

value
13831060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e18923b916f3304ce6cd54cf4d637fcb8bc18b1 OP_EQUAL
address
37MMFg96BsnEQKMnYPQFF7sw53keAdJUhR
transaction
e36cc598c59cf35c60b8afc196b86762ad0ae430c0b6c878ea68c549dbf357af
spent
true